Job description

An exciting opportunity has become available to join our team as anActivities Coordinatorat Carders Court Care Village! Your day will be very varied. Developing meaningful activities, delivering engaging sessions and supporting events and outings. You will be organising a programme of therapeutic, and recreational activities that enhance the lives of our residents.

This is a fantastic opportunity to join us and be part of a team that makes a real change in people's lives.

Who we are looking for

  • Ability to plan daily and weekly activities programme for our residents
  • Run group events that may include craft classes, movies, music, films, quizzes, bingo, reminiscence, entertainment, etc
  • Plan special celebration days such as Easter, Christmas etc
  • Good communication and organisational skills
  • Team player
  • Ability to work on own initiative
  • Friendly, creative and confident
